Agenda Agenda: Credit Check Announcements Naviance Review Letters of Recommendation

Graduation Requirements / Credit Checks English: 4 credits Math: 4 credits, one must be Algebra 2 Science: 3 credits, one must be a physical science (integrated science) & one must be life science (biology). Social Studies: 3 credits which must include World History, American History, Economics, Principles of Democracy Fine Arts: 1 credit Health:.50 credit Physical Education:.50 credit (ea. PE class is only worth.25 credit) Electives: 4 credits

Diploma Options Standard Diploma (Required for Graduation) Honors Diploma (Must earn at least 7 of the 8 criteria) English 4 credits English 4 credits Social Studies 3 credits Social Studies 4 credits Science 3 credits (Physical Science, Life Science and Advanced Science) Mathematics 4 credits (One of which must be Algebra 2) Health/P.E..(5 HEALTH AND.5 PHYSICA(L EDUATION)) 1 credit (2 PE waivers for Marching Band, Cheerleading or approved athletics can be used in place of PE) Science 4 credits (Advanced Lab Based Science) Mathematics 4 credits (Must include Algebra 1, Geometry, Algebra 2 and an additional Advanced Math) Foreign Language 3 credits 0r 2+2 (3 credits of one foreign language or two credits each of two foreign languages) Fine Arts 1 credit Fine Arts 1 credit Electives 4 credits Unweighted GPA of 3.5 or higher Total = 20 credits 27 or higher on the ACT or 1210 or higher on SAT

Pickerington High School North Graduation Requirements In addition to the required graduation credits, students are required to take 7 endof course exams and achieve one of the following to receive a diploma: Option 1: Students must accumulate a minimum of 18 points from scores on their end of course exams to become eligible for a diploma. To ensure that students are well rounded, they must earn a minimum of 4 points in math, 4 points in English and 6 points across Science and Social Studies. Option 2: Students earn remediation-free scores in English language arts and mathematics on a nationally recognized college admission exam. Option 3: Earn a State Board of Education-approved, industry recognized credential or a state-issued license for practice in a career and achieve a score that demonstrates workforce readiness and employability on the WorkKeys assessment.

Option 1: Class of 2019 and beyond take 7 required end of course exams. English 9 English 10 Algebra 1 Geometry American History American Government. Biology Earn at least 4 points in English tests Earn at least 4 points in Math tests Earn at least 6 points in Science and Social Studies Tests

Option 2: College Readiness Score on a National Admission Test ACT English 18 Reading 22 Math 22 SAT Critical Reading 450 Math 520

Transcripts TRANSCRIPTS: Colleges request that students submit an academic transcript to their college/university as part of the application process. To request that the PHSN School Counseling Office send a student s transcript to a college or university: Complete and submit a GREEN transcript request form. (Available in PHSN School Counseling Office). Make sure its filled out completely. Fill out one for EACH college/university. Please hand the GREEN transcript request form to Ms. Chandler (School Counseling Office Secretary). It is not necessary to make an appointment with the student s school counselor to submit the transcript request form (unless the student has questions about the process). Allow 10 school days for transcripts to be submitted. Be aware of deadlines. Progress of the application process will be visible on Naviance Family Connection in the colleges tab under colleges I m applying to. When the school counselors have submitted the student s transcript and accompanying forms, the status will say Initial materials submitted.

ACT/SAT Scores ACT/SAT SCORES: Check to see which colleges on student s list of prospective colleges require that ACT or SAT TEST SCORES are sent directly from the testing company. Some colleges require that test scores come directly from the testing company. Please understand that this is your responsibility! How to request that official test scores are sent to colleges: a. ACT: www.actstudent.org ACT will send only the score date you ask them to send. There is a fee for this.. http://www.actstudent.org/scores/send/costs.html When you register for an ACT Test, you receive four free test score reports of that test score sent to the colleges you designate. b. SAT: www.collegeboard.org SAT will send all of your SAT/SAT Subject Scores that you select to a college for a fee. When you register for a SAT Test, you receive four free test score reports of that test score sent to the colleges you designate.

School Counselor Recommendations Most colleges request that student s school counselors submit a recommendation, secondary school report, and school profile. The PHSN School Counselors will complete these recommendations and forms through Naviance and will submit them electronically. It is not necessary for the student to give those forms to the counselor. The PHSN School Counselors request that all seniors needing recommendations from their assigned school counselor provide their counselor with a curriculum vitae or resume at the time that the request is made Allow a minimum of ten (10) school days for the school counseling department to submit the recommendation and accompanying forms.
